Does it vary between manufacturers?

My Samsung 850 EVO SSD reports numbers for both 'raw value' and 'value'.
Yes it varies between manufacturers. In most cases the normalized value is more useful. (Except if you want something like the actual number of sectors read or the actual temperature.) The normalized values should range from 100 (highest) to 0 (lowest) with sometimes a critical threshold higher than zero.
